RIVER PRINCESS

RIVER PRINCESS was launched in June 2004. Builder and owner Rodney Collard writes "This design was drafted on paper from photographs from WoodenBoat magazine. We read up on stitch-and-glue construction. We started with a bow and stern piece and then made a frame to mold the boat out of 1/4" plywood. Most of the time spent on construction was waiting for each stage of epoxy to cure. I had so much fun building the boat with my 10-year-old daughter, Jessica.
